What are the main climate risks in Glen Fergus?
ClimateNest's suburb model rates Glen Fergus's dominant climate risk as extreme heat at 5/10 on a 0–10 index, followed by damaging wind (4/10) and severe storm (4/10). These are suburb-level averages — an address-level report is needed to confirm the risk of a specific property in Glen Fergus.
What share of Glen Fergus is exposed to high bushfire risk?
ClimateNest's hazard overlay maps 15.6% of Glen Fergus in high-risk zones for bushfire, with a further 60.9% in moderate-risk zones. Suburb-level exposure is not uniform — individual properties can differ from these averages, so an address-level check is recommended.
